A bond ladder is a collection of bonds having staggered maturity dates that are structured to pay a fixed amount of interest. Instead of putting all of your ...Bond ladder strategy refers to an investment strategy in which there is the process of buying a portfolio of bonds that have different dates of maturity. The bonds are spread across these dates. As each bond reaches the maturity period, the investor can invest it into a fresh bond at the longer end of the ladder.Cost of TIPS Ladder. Jun 19, 2018 · If you stopped buying T-Bills, you would get $1,000 back each week until all have matured. TreasuryDirect now has a minimum purchase amount of $100, allowed in increments of $100. This means you would need to commit 4 x $100 = $400 to create a weekly ladder. Other brokerage firms may impose a higher $1,000 minimum per T-Bill.

A popular way to hold individual bonds is by building a portfolio of bonds with various maturities: This is called a bond ladder. Ladders can help create predictable streams of income, reduce exposure to volatile stocks, and manage some potential risks from changing interest rates. See moreA ladder can be as simple as this: One bond maturing in one year. One bond maturing in two years. One bond maturing in three years. One bond maturing in four years.
